I'm trying to reconstruct the growth of Yahoo in its early years.

I have been unable to track down employee numbers for the period
between its IPO and the year 1999.

According to the link below, Yahoo had 49 employees at its IPO in April 1996.
http://docs.yahoo.com/info/misc/history.html

This article gives headcount as 1728 for Sept 30, 1999:
http://sanjose.bizjournals.com/sanjose/stories/1999/11/22/story2.html

*I am looking for any headcount data between these two dates.*

I have already tried:
- Yahoo Annual Reports (they don't give headcounts for this time period)
- The Wayback Machine ("About Yahoo" pages on www.yahoo.com don't give
headcounts during this period)
